Crafts Designed for Children: Simple Projects, Big Smiles

Making a *Mother’s Day craft* with children is a fantastic way to involve them in the celebration and create a beautiful, personalized gift that Mom will absolutely adore. These projects are designed to be easy, safe, and fun, perfect for little hands to help with.

Handprint Art is a classic for a reason: it’s easy, adorable, and creates a lasting memory. You’ll need washable paint in Mom’s favorite colors, thick paper or canvas, and a paintbrush. Guide the child to paint their hand and then press it firmly onto the paper, creating a handprint. This can be done several times, layering different colors. Afterwards, you can turn it into a flower by painting stems and leaves, or a heart by adding other details. Encourage kids to write their names and a special message. Frame it to make it even more special. Handprint art is a beautiful and touching *Mother’s Day craft*!

Painted Rocks are a creative and engaging activity. All you need are smooth rocks of various sizes, acrylic paints, paintbrushes, and possibly some sealant to make them durable. The children can paint these rocks with various designs: flowers, hearts, ladybugs, or simple patterns. The versatility of the craft makes it fun and allows for experimentation. Mom can then use these painted rocks as paperweights, garden decorations, or simply as little treasures to admire.

Mother’s Day Cards are a must-have. This allows children to show their love for Mom. You can get creative with card design. Simple colored cardstock, markers, glitter, and stickers are your friends. Consider making a pop-up card, where a paper heart or flower pops out when the card is opened. Alternatively, create a scratch-off card by painting a square with a mixture of dish soap and acrylic paint, and then write a special message underneath. They can write personalized messages about why they love their mom and what makes her special.

Salt Dough Ornaments are another excellent choice. Salt dough is incredibly easy to make and a fun activity for kids. You’ll need salt, flour, and water. Mix them to create a dough. Then, you can roll it out and shape it with cookie cutters, creating hearts, stars, or any other shape you desire. Use a straw to make a hole for hanging. Bake them in the oven until they’re firm. Once cooled, the children can decorate the ornaments with paint, glitter, or even use their fingerprints to add a unique touch. A great *Mother’s Day craft*!

DIY Projects: Crafted with Care and Personalization

If you’re looking for a more involved crafting experience, these DIY projects offer the chance to create truly unique and personalized gifts that Mom will cherish for years to come.

Photo Gifts are a fantastic way to showcase memories and create a heartfelt gift. Gather your favorite photos of Mom and start creating. A simple photo album or scrapbook allows you to display the pictures with heartfelt captions. You can even personalize a mug or coaster. Another fun idea is a photo collage. You can arrange your photos on a canvas or poster board and customize it to fit her style. Consider including photos from different periods in her life to create a timeline of memories. Photo gifts are a touching and long-lasting *Mother’s Day craft* idea.

Bath Bombs or Soaps provide Mom with a spa-like experience at home. This can be a more involved process but rewarding. Research a recipe that contains ingredients such as baking soda, citric acid, Epsom salts, essential oils, and colors. You can experiment with different scents, colors, and add-ins, such as dried flowers or herbs. Be careful in your use of essential oils. This *Mother’s Day craft* will add relaxation and luxury to Mom’s daily routine.

Personalized Jewelry is a wonderful way to give something that she can wear and cherish. Create beaded bracelets or necklaces using her favorite colors and beads. You can also create stamped metal pendants, writing her initials, a special date, or a short, meaningful message on them. You can buy jewelry-making kits or create your own. The customization options are endless. This makes for a beautiful and elegant *Mother’s Day craft*.

Candle Making is a relaxing and customizable craft. Gather supplies like soy or beeswax, wicks, essential oils for scent, and containers. You can create scented candles with her favorite fragrances. This can be a fantastic *Mother’s Day craft* for anyone.

Crafts for All Ages: A Collaborative Approach

These *Mother’s Day craft* ideas are designed to be flexible and can be adjusted to accommodate a range of skill levels, making them perfect for anyone to participate in.

Flower Vases or Pots is a great way to combine art and gardening. You can decorate plain vases or pots using decoupage techniques, painting them with custom designs, or using stickers and stencils. It’s a beautiful and unique way to display flowers and a thoughtful *Mother’s Day craft*.

Decorated Frames give a home a more personal touch. Find plain wooden frames from craft stores or thrift shops. You can decorate them with paint, fabric scraps, glitter, or anything else you fancy. The frame can hold a cherished photo or a piece of artwork made by the children, making for a truly heartwarming *Mother’s Day craft*.

Coasters are both practical and beautiful, making them a wonderful *Mother’s Day craft*. You can personalize them with tile, paint, resin, or other materials. You can paint simple patterns or designs, create mosaic-like coasters, or use resin to encapsulate pressed flowers or decorative elements. The choices are endless.

Materials and Tools: The Crafting Essentials

To embark on your *Mother’s Day craft* adventure, you’ll need a selection of materials and tools. Here are some of the most common:

Essential Craft Supplies: Construction paper, cardstock, paint (acrylic, watercolors), brushes, glue (glue sticks, liquid glue), scissors, markers, crayons, colored pencils, glitter, ribbon, beads, yarn, and fabric scraps.

Sourcing Your Supplies: Craft stores are a great place to find all your supplies in one place. Online shops like Etsy or Amazon are great resources. You can also utilize recycled materials from around your home, like empty jars, old magazines, or fabric scraps.

Setting Up Your Craft Space: Ensure you have a well-lit and comfortable workspace. Cover your surfaces with newspaper or a protective mat to prevent paint spills. Organize your supplies in containers or drawers to make them easy to find and store.

Troubleshooting and Crafting Success

Crafting is a journey, not always a perfect process. Here are some tips for troubleshooting and ensuring a smooth crafting experience.

Dealing with Glue Spills and Paint Messes: Use drop cloths, aprons, and consider washable paints and glues. Clean up any messes promptly, and don’t be afraid to embrace a little mess—it’s part of the fun!

Involving Children in the Process: Provide age-appropriate tasks and supervision. Let them choose the colors and designs. Encourage them to participate as much as they can.

Safety First: Use non-toxic materials and follow all manufacturer’s instructions. Supervise young children closely when they’re using scissors or other tools.
